1999 Mitsubishi Minicab 660 CS Specs


OVERVIEW

With a fuel consumption of 39.2 mpg US - 47 mpg UK - 6.0 L/100km, a curb weight of 2821 lbs (1280 kg), the Mitsubishi Minicab 660 CS has a 3 cylinder SOHC engine, a Regular gasoline engine 3G83. This engine 3G83 produces a maximum power of 48.6 PS (48 bhp - 35.7 kW) at 6000 rpm and a maximum torque of 61.7 Nm (45.5 lb.ft - 6.3 kg.m) at 4000 rpm. The engine power is transmitted to the road by the rear wheel drive (FR) with a 5MT gearbox. For stopping power, the Mitsubishi Minicab 660 CS braking system includes drum at the rear and disk at the front. Stock tire sizes are 145 on 12 inch rims at the rear and 145 on 12 inch rims at the front. Chassis details - Mitsubishi Minicab 660 CS has 3 link coil spring rear suspension and strut front suspension for road holding and ride confort.
